Manufacturer's product description
* Part of Marmot's Synthetic Backpacking bag line featuring Wave Construction. These bags will keep you warm and dry in the wettest of environments.
* Spirafil 120 insulation - a unique blend of spiral hollow fibers for loft and low denier polyester fibers for warmth, softness and compressibility. Thermally bonded for high tear strength and long-term durability. Exceptional combination of softness, lightweight and compactibility.
* Wave construction - overlapping waves of insulation eliminate cold spots, increases loft and keeps you toasty warm.
* Durable Summit N-190 WR 70 denier nylon taffeta liner and shell.
* Stash pocket.
* 'Feely' draw cords.
* Snagless draft tube.
* Two hang loops.
* Micro muff.
* Compression stuff sack included.

...The Piute (also availble; woman\'s Piute) is a warm and cozy sleepingbag. Its price is a reflection of its quality and appears reasonable compared to other bags of similar specifictions. Its lightweight design is very useful for back packing or anytime that space is at a premium. It comes with a small stuff sack that it fits into neatly, although could be compressed further (not recomended for down bags, especially not for longer periods of time).
The hood offers superb protection from the cold although it could possibly benefit from a second draw string baffle around the neck.shoulders area. However the drawstring around the top of the hood to enclose around the face is confortable and good at keeping the heat in whist allowing freedom of movement.
